pearltrees
One of the start-ups that has me intrigued is pearltrees. This self-titled social curation platform allows you to share pearls with others on the Internet. These little pearls can be any link, webpage, video image, etc you find and like on the Web. It’s a bit like having an online bookmarking tool that can be highly intuitive, organized and shared with your team members.

Nothing should stop you from taking pearltrees and using this tool to get organized in your business. I’ll be sure to watch how these guys fare throughout 2011.

Podio
Podio takes collaboration to new heights in 2011 and beyond. This start-up offers you a platform on which you can build your own apps. You are in charge of creating your own work spaces, allowing you to work to your rhythm. There are integrated social features and plenty of extras such as your own handpicked:

  • Apps
  • Spaces
  • Stream
  • Tasks
  • Contacts
  • Calendar

Launched in 2009, Podio has only recently come out of stealth mode and is set to take the online world by storm in 2011. You can register your interest into this software now to be one of the first on board when they go public.

eTask.it
eTask.it is considered to be one of the hottest nearshoring start-ups in the Americas right now. This intuitive integrated project management tool allows companies and service professionals to work with and handle their clients and team in the cloud.

eTask.it harnesses the global trend of collaboration. It helps you to manage your processes, your partners and your people. Your company will be more transparent and therefore attract long-term relationships. You can choose your preferred tool with this platform, depending on your priorities and objectives.
